Colcannon with Spring Greens

This beloved Irish comfort dish brings together creamy mashed potatoes with sautéed cabbage and tender greens, finished with butter and fresh herbs.

Ingredients:
1½ pounds potatoes, peeled and cut into chunks
½ small green cabbage, thinly sliced
2 tablespoons butter, plus more for serving
½ cup milk or cream
2 green onions or a small handful chopped herbs (parsley or chives work beautifully)
Salt and freshly ground black pepper

Method:
1. Place the potatoes in a pot of salted water and bring to a boil. Cook until tender, about 15–18 minutes. Drain well and return to the warm pot.

2. Meanwhile, melt the butter in a large skillet over medium heat. Add the sliced cabbage and cook until softened and lightly sweet, about 6–8 minutes.

3. Mash the potatoes with the milk or cream until smooth and fluffy. Season with salt and pepper.
Fold the sautéed cabbage and green onions or herbs into the mashed potatoes. Taste and adjust seasoning as needed. Serve warm with a small well in the center and a pat of butter melting into the top.
